-
公开(公告)号:US20200089689A1
公开(公告)日:2020-03-19
申请号:US16692240
申请日:2019-11-22
发明人: Jonathan Roger Greenblatt , Sundar R. Krishnan , James J. Rea , David J. Watson , Prasanta Kumar Parida , Amit Ashok Pathak , M. Ehsan Khan , Umashankar Awasthi
摘要: The present invention provides for inline/parallel processing of data messages, specifically data response messages, to both transform and parse the data in one single pass. Parsing includes extracting common data elements (such as, error codes, fault codes, status codes and the like) from the message and deleting generic headers from the messages. In specific embodiments of the invention, the parallel processing of the present invention is made possible by implementation of a SAX parser. In such embodiments of the invention, the SAX parser implements a single filter to both transform and parse the data response messages simultaneously.
-
公开(公告)号:US11061921B2
公开(公告)日:2021-07-13
申请号:US16692240
申请日:2019-11-22
发明人: Jonathan Roger Greenblatt , Sundar R. Krishnan , James J. Rea , David J. Watson , Prasanta Kumar Parida , Amit Ashok Pathak , M. Ehsan Khan , Umashankar Awasthi
IPC分类号: G06F16/25 , G06F16/84 , G06F40/154 , G06F40/221 , G06F40/143
摘要: The present invention provides for inline/parallel processing of data messages, specifically data response messages, to both transform and parse the data in one single pass. Parsing includes extracting common data elements (such as, error codes, fault codes, status codes and the like) from the message and deleting generic headers from the messages. In specific embodiments of the invention, the parallel processing of the present invention is made possible by implementation of a SAX parser. In such embodiments of the invention, the SAX parser implements a single filter to both transform and parse the data response messages simultaneously.
-
公开(公告)号:US20170103113A1
公开(公告)日:2017-04-13
申请号:US14879206
申请日:2015-10-09
发明人: Jonathan Roger Greenblatt , Sundar R. Krishnan , James J. Rea , David J. Watson , Prasanta Kumar Parida , Amit Ashok Pathak , M. Ehsan Khan , Umashankar Awasthi
IPC分类号: G06F17/30
摘要: The present invention provides for inline/parallel processing of data messages, specifically data response messages, to both transform and parse the data in one single pass. Parsing includes extracting common data elements (such as, error codes, fault codes, status codes and the like) from the message and deleting generic headers from the messages. In specific embodiments of the invention, the parallel processing of the present invention is made possible by implementation of a SAX parser. In such embodiments of the invention, the SAX parser implements a single filter to both transform and parse the data response messages simultaneously.
-
公开(公告)号:US10303753B2
公开(公告)日:2019-05-28
申请号:US14879215
申请日:2015-10-09
发明人: Jonathan Roger Greenblatt , Sundar R. Krishnan , James J. Rea , David J. Watson , Prasanta Kumar Parida , Amit Ashok Pathak , M. Ehsan Khan , Umashankar Awasthi
摘要: The present invention provides copybook flat data conversion with inline transformation. Specifically, a streaming intermediary formatted data message is generated as a result of converting/transforming a flat file format (non-XML (Extensible Markup Language) format), such as raw fixed-length field COBOL (Common Business-Oriented Language) copybook format or the like. The streaming intermediary format is not fully held in memory, but rather is directly transformed/converted, using XSLT (Extensible Stylesheet Language Transformations) processing, into a target format, such as structured XML or the like. By directly streaming the intermediary format to the XSLT process without holding the entire data message in memory, the present invention utilizes less memory and, as such, less memory is needed to be reclaimed.
-
公开(公告)号:US20170103078A1
公开(公告)日:2017-04-13
申请号:US14879215
申请日:2015-10-09
发明人: Jonathan Roger Greenblatt , Sundar R. Krishnan , James J. Rea , David J. Watson , Prasant Kumar Parida , Amit Ashok Pathak , M. Ehsan Khan , Umashankar Awasthi
CPC分类号: G06F17/227 , G06F17/2247 , G06F17/2258 , G06F17/272
摘要: The present invention provides copybook flat data conversion with inline transformation. Specifically, a streaming intermediary formatted data message is generated as a result of converting/transforming a flat file format (non-XML (Extensible Markup Language) format), such as raw fixed-length field COBOL (Common Business-Oriented Language) copybook format or the like. The streaming intermediary format is not fully held in memory, but rather is directly transformed/converted, using XSLT (Extensible Stylesheet Language Transformations) processing, into a target format, such as structured XML or the like. By directly streaming the intermediary format to the XSLT process without holding the entire data message in memory, the present invention utilizes less memory and, as such, less memory is needed to be reclaimed.
-
-
-
-